Old Fashioned Whole Wheat Apple Pancakes
Ingredients
The pancakes
-
¾
cups
all purpose flour
-
¾
cups
whole wheat flour
-
3½
teaspoons
baking powder
-
1
teaspoon
salt
-
1
tablespoon
honey
-
3
tablespoons
melted butter
-
1¼
cups
milk
-
1
large
egg
The apples
-
2
apples
-
¼
cup
brown sugar
-
¼
cup
flour
-
½
teaspoon
cinnamon
Toppings
-
maple syrup
-
chopped pecans
-
powdered sugar
-
vanilla yogurt
-
honey
Instructions
- Mix the flours, baking powder, and salt in a small bowl.
- In another bowl, whisk together honey, melted butter, milk, and egg.
- Combine both mixtures, stirring until mostly smooth.
- Core and slice the apples thinly, then dust with a mixture of brown sugar, flour, and cinnamon.
- Heat a skillet with a small pat of butter, add the apples, and let them soften.
- Pour pancake batter over the softened apples and cook until bubbles form, then flip and cook until done.
- Serve warm with desired toppings.
